يمكنك استخدام proc أحادي المتغير لحساب المتوسط والوسيط ووضع المتغيرات في SAS بسرعة. يستخدم هذا الإجراء بناء الجملة الأساسي التالي: proc univariate data =my_data; run ; يوضح المثال التالي كيفية استخدام بناء الجملة هذا عمليًا. مثال: حساب المتوسط والوسيط والمنوال لجميع...
يمكنك استخدام الطرق التالية لحساب عدد القيم المفقودة في SAS: الطريقة الأولى: حساب القيم المفقودة للمتغيرات الرقمية proc means data =my_data NMISS ; run ; الطريقة الثانية: حساب القيم المفقودة لمتغيرات الأحرف proc sql; select nmiss(char1) as char1_miss, nmiss(char2) as char2_miss...
الانحدار اللوجستي هو طريقة يمكننا استخدامها لتناسب نموذج الانحدار عندما يكون متغير الاستجابة ثنائيًا. لتقييم مدى ملاءمة نموذج الانحدار اللوجستي لمجموعة البيانات، يمكننا النظر إلى المقياسين التاليين: الحساسية: احتمال أن يتنبأ النموذج بنتيجة إيجابية لملاحظة ما عندما تكون النتيجة إيجابية بالفعل....
في عرض ألعاب قديم يسمى Let’s Make a Deal ، قدم المضيف مونتي هول للمتسابقين ثلاثة أبواب. يحتوي أحد الأبواب على جائزة بينما لا يحتوي البابان الآخران على جائزة. سيطلب مونتي من المتسابق اختيار الباب الذي يعتقد أنه يحتوي على الجائزة....
يمكن استخدام حلقة DO في SAS لتنفيذ إجراء ما لعدد معين من المرات. هناك ثلاث حلقات DO أساسية في SAS: 1. اصنع الحلقة data data1; x = 0; do i = 1 to 10; x = i*4; output ; end ;...
يمكنك استخدام الأول. والأخير. في SAS لتحديد الأعمال الأولى والملاحظات الأخيرة حسب المجموعة في مجموعة بيانات SAS. وفيما يلي ملخص لما تفعله كل وظيفة: يقوم FIRST.variable_name بتعيين قيمة 1 للملاحظة الأولى في المجموعة وقيمة 0 لجميع الملاحظات الأخرى في المجموعة. LAST.variable_name...
يمكنك استخدام عبارة SELECT-WHEN في SAS لتعيين قيم لمتغير جديد بناءً على قيم المتغير الفئوي الموجود في مجموعة البيانات. يستخدم هذا البيان بناء الجملة الأساسي التالي: data new_data; set my_data; select (Existing_Column); when ('value1') New_Column= 1 ; when ('value2') New_Column= 2...
يمكنك استخدام الطرق التالية لحساب عدد القيم الفريدة لكل مجموعة في R: الطريقة الأولى: استخدم Base R results <- aggregate(data=df, values_var~group_var, function (x) length ( unique (x))) الطريقة الثانية: استخدم dplyr library (dplyr) results <- df %>% group_by(group_var) %>% summarize(count =...
يمكنك استخدام وسيطة bins لتحديد عدد الصناديق المراد استخدامها في الرسم البياني في ggplot2 : library (ggplot2) ggplot(df, aes (x=x)) + geom_histogram(bins= 10 ) توضح الأمثلة التالية كيفية استخدام هذه الوسيطة عمليًا. مثال: قم بتعيين عدد الصناديق للرسم البياني في ggplot2...
يمكنك استخدام الطرق التالية لتصفية إطار البيانات حسب التواريخ في R باستخدام الحزمة dplyr : الطريقة الأولى: تصفية الصفوف بعد التاريخ df %>% filter(date_column > ' 2022-01-01 ') الطريقة الثانية: تصفية الصفوف قبل التاريخ df %>% filter(date_column < ' 2022-01-01 ')...